Basketball Recap: Westwood Panthers vs. Pine Knights
Westwood won the last time they faced Pine and things went their way on Monday too. The Westwood Panthers came out on top against the Pine Knights by a score of 63-50.

Westwood's win was the result of several impressive offensive performances. One of the most notable came from Joseph Weathers, who went 6 for 11 from beyond the arc en route to 18 points. The dominant performance gave Weathers a new career-high in points. Marquan Burgess was another key player, going 5 of 10 on his way to 10 points along with seven assists and four steals.
Westwood was working as a unit and finished the game with 15 assists. That's the most assists they've managed all season.
The victory got Westwood back to even at 10-10. As for Pine,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ost six of their last eight matches, which put a noticeable dent in their 11-9 record this season.
Westwood did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 38-37 defeat against Okeechobee on the 22nd. As for Pine,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next contest, a 59-41 loss against Palm Beach Central on the 22nd.
